Burgher

/ˈbɜː(ɹ)ɡə(ɹ)/ · noun

Meaning

A citizen of a borough or town, especially one belonging to the middle class..

Definitions by Sense

  1. A citizen of a borough or town, especially one belonging to the middle class.
  2. A prosperous member of the community; a middle-class citizen (may connote complacency).
